Last night I had the opportunity to attend an event to celebrate the launch of Canada's very first Pinkberry store, which has just opened in the Village at West Vancouver's Park Royal Shopping Centre. And what an event it was: free "froyo" with all the toppings, sparkling wine, and great company-- complete with a live performance by Bonnie Dune, whose drummer is none other than infamous BC-boy Cory Monteith (better known as "Finn" from Glee!).{toppings galore. my favourites: mochi, blackberries and blueberries- yum!}

I was impressed by the array of flavours and toppings there were to choose from, seeing that I had been used to seemingly much less from other Vancouver frozen yogurt joints in the past. The yogurt itself was just tart enough and the fruit toppings were fresh and juicy.
